‘Nice Days’
A holiday in the South of France…
Inspired by Regina’s artwork.
Tumblr media
It had been quite the ‘vacation’ as the Americans say. Was he an American now, he pondered, as he looked at the azure sea stretching for miles in front of the villa?
Guy said they were ‘semi-American’, an acknowledgement that while they resided in Hancock Park and worked in Hollywood, they still drunk their tea out of china cups and saucers, ate aubergines and not eggplants, and after a late night liked to wake up to a full English.
America was a long way away right now though. They left New York 4 weeks ago, crossing the Atlantic on a very smart ship, for reasons of both work and pleasure. After business meetings and theatre trips in London and an afternoon visit to Downton to say hello to Thomas’s old colleagues (Carson’s spluttering when Thomas - and Guy - walked into the kitchen was a wonder to behold), they’d travelled to the South of France for two weeks relaxation.
And Thomas was sublimely relaxed. A week in a country house surrounded by lavender fields had been followed by a stay at a villa by the sea, in Nice. The city was packed with well to do Europeans, but he and Guy had kept themselves to themselves, happy to luxuriate in the view, the food, and each other.
He once wished he could go to the South of France. And here he was. With his lover. Mind boggling how a life can change in an instant.
‘What are you smiling about darling?’
Guy appeared from the adjoining kitchen, drinks in hand.
‘How much I love this. How much I love you’.
Guy flushed, bending to kiss the top of his head. ‘I love you too darling’.
As he sat down on the whicker loveseat, he reached back and put his arm around Thomas, who leant in and rested his head on his shoulder.
As the sea sparkled and the sun shone, Thomas decided that yeah, he could get used to this.
